Active Ingredient

Ethyl Alcohol 62%

Purpose

Antiseptic

Uses

For handwashing. Decreases bacteria on skin

Warnings

For external use only

Flammable. Keep away from fire or flame

Stop Use And Ask A Doctor

if rash or irritation develops

if condition persists for more than 72 hours consult a doctor

Keep Out Of Reach Of Children

If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center immediately

Directions

Apply onto hands and rub until dry

Children under 6 months: Ask a doctor

Inactive Ingredients

Aloe barbadensis Leave Juice, Carbomer, Fragrance, Glycerin, Triethanolamine, Water
